In most cases of atopic dermatitis, the microscopic allergens penetrate directly through the skin.Ītopic allergies can occur seasonally or all year around depending on the presence of the allergen. Atopy (also known as atopic dermatitis)Ītopic dermatitis is an allergic reaction to certain substances in the environment, including pollen, moulds, dust mites and even animal dander (skin or hair fragments).There are three main types of allergies in dogs: We also discuss how allergies are diagnosed and the dog breeds that more prone to skin conditions. This article explains the different types of allergies in dogs, their symptoms and how they can be treated. The more contact the animal makes with the allergen, the more the body releases histamines (chemical compounds involved in immune responses) and the itchier the animal will be.Īllergies in dogs generally can’t be cured but can be managed. White blood cells in the body build up a memory of the allergen. An allergic reaction is the result of more than one exposure to an allergenic substance. Metals placed high in the reactivity series can displace metals lower in their salt solutions. The reducing power of metals weakens as you go through the series.Įlectropositivity of elements also decreases as one moves down the metal reactivity series.Īll metals above hydrogen in the activity range release hydrogen gas when reacted with dilute HCl or dilute H2SO4. These metals tarnish/corrode very easily. Metals at the top of the series of reactivity are strong reducing agents because they oxidize quickly. Metals at the top of the series are very reactive and, therefore, they do not occur free in nature, while the metals at the bottom of the series are least reactive and, therefore, they normally occur free in nature. The metals which are placed below hydrogen are less reactive than hydrogen and cannot displace hydrogen from its compounds like water and acids.Ī more reactive metal (placed higher in the reactivity series) can displace the less reactive metal from the solution of its salt. The metals which have been placed above hydrogen are more reactive than hydrogen and can displace hydrogen from its compounds like water and acids to liberate hydrogen gas. Lithium is the most reactive and platinum is the least reactive metal. The metal which is higher in the activity series is more reactive than the other. The reactivity series is very useful as it gives the following information: Reactivity Series of Metal chart are given below: Metals with high atomic numbers are more reactive because their electrons are far from the positively charged nucleus thus, they can be easily removed. Metals form positively charged ions because they tend to lose electrons. The reactivity of metals is due to their incomplete outer orbitals or their electron configuration. It is also known as a series of activities. Thus, a metal reactivity series can be defined as a series of metals in order of reactivity from highest to lowest. Red creeping thyme is a commonly used perennial ground cover with foliage that is usually a dark, rich green color.Ĭreeping thyme grows as a low mat, only two to three inches tall, with pink, magenta, lavender, or white flowers. They are principally grown for the fine texture of their pointed blue-green leaves as they spread out to softly blanket the ground, but they also produce flowers of various colors, depending on the type. While some thyme species are upright and shrub-like, creeping types are low-growing with a vine-like habit. Most thyme plants are perennial in moderate climates. During summer it produces lavender flower spikes. This plant produces shiny, variegated, greenish gold lemon-scented leaves. This creeping thyme has thick stems of wooly foliage which makes it hardier and more waterwise than other creeping thyme.It will grow in almost any well-drained soil in full sun and can tolerate occasional foot traffic. It grows about 1 inch tall and spreads up to 18 inches wide which makes it an excellent choice for planting between flagstones and other stone pavers in your garden. ‘Pink Chintz’ creeping thyme is a low, tight growing creeping thyme that blooms in mid-spring, creating a carpet of salmon-pink flowers. It grows up to 1-2 inches tall (2-5 cm) and will spread over time to 12-18 inches (30-45 cm). The plant is also deer and rabbit resistant. It bears clusters of tiny, bright pink flowers rich in nectar which attracts butterflies. It’s a popular ground cover,blooming profusely from early to mid summer. ‘Magic Carpet’ creeping thyme plant is a dwarf, aromatic sub-shrub forming a tight cushion of tiny, rounded, dark green leaves and is evergreen in mild winters.
